Abstract
By the zero curvature condition in classically integrable system, the generating functions for integrals of motion and equations for solving K+/- matrices are obtained in two-dimensional integrable systems on a finite intervel with independent boundary conditions on each end. Cla ssically integrable boundary conditions will be found by solving K+/- matrices. Zn this paper, we develop a Hamiltonian method in classicall y integrable system with independent boundary conditions on eath end. Our result can be applied to more integrable systems than those associ ated with E.K. Sklyanin's approach.
